Responsibilities

  • Greet patients and assist with intake procedures, including collecting medical histories and updating records
  • Measure vital signs such as blood pressure, pulse, and oxygen saturation levels
  • Prepare patients for examinations by performing initial assessments and explaining procedures
  • Assist ophthalmologists during examinations and minor procedures, ensuring aseptic techniques are maintained
  • Operate EMR systems such as NextGen and other electronic medical record (EMR) platforms to document patient information accurately
  • Manage medical records in compliance with HIPAA regulations, ensuring confidentiality and security of patient data
  • Conduct basic eye tests and assist with optical measurements for eyewear fitting
  • Support front desk operations including scheduling appointments, verifying insurance information, and handling patient inquiries
  • Engage in retail sales of eyewear products when appropriate, applying retail math skills for transactions
  • Maintain a clean and organized clinical environment adhering to safety protocols and aseptic techniques
  • Collaborate with team members on patient care plans, including pediatrics or specialized cases such as ophthalmology or clinic-specific needs
